What is the difference between Temporary Computer Data Scientist vs Temporary Data Analyst?

AspectTemporary Computer Data ScientistTemporary Data Analyst
Required CredentialsBachelor's or higher in CS, Data Science, or related; often some experience with machine learningBachelor's in Statistics, Math, or related; proficiency in data visualization and basic analysis
Work EnvironmentTech companies, research labs, or consulting firms; project-based rolesBusiness, finance, marketing sectors; supporting decision-making processes
Employer & Industry UsageUsed across tech, healthcare, finance; often in innovative or R&D projectsCommon in corporate settings, retail, and marketing departments

Temporary Computer Data Scientists focus on advanced analytics, machine learning, and predictive modeling, requiring more technical expertise. Temporary Data Analysts primarily handle data collection, cleaning, and basic analysis to support business decisions. While both roles involve working with data, Data Scientists typically require stronger programming and statistical skills, whereas Data Analysts focus on reporting and visualization.

Can I get a temporary computer data scientist job with no experience?

Temporary computer data scientist roles typically require some experience in data analysis, programming, or related skills such as Python, R, or SQL. Entry-level positions may be available for those with relevant coursework, certifications, or strong analytical aptitude, but most employers prefer candidates with prior experience or demonstrated skills.
